It's cool to see there is actually someone else on this board interested in Ultima.

If you do decide to play it, be sure to keep a notebook handy (yes, an actual real-life notebook) because there is no auto-journal, GPS quest-trackers, or any other "hold your hand" type crap in the game. The storyline, and NPC conversations are huge, so if you read or discover something you feel is important, write it down.

There is also no auto-map. There is a world map, but in order to see your location on the world map, you must find or purchase a sextant.
There are also magical "peering gems" which give you limited-time access to a special zoomable map which is handy in dungeons.

This is by no means an easy game, but patience, combat tactics, and attention to detail will all be your friend in your quest to rescue Lord British from the Underworld...... lol
